Typical House Extension Cost Structures

House extension costs are typically calculated based on square meterage, ranging from £1,500-3,000 per square meter depending on project complexity. For smaller projects like single storey extensions, costs may be higher per square meter due to fixed overhead costs. Larger double storey extensions often command lower per-square-meter rates due to economies of scale.

Square Meterage-Based Costs: Most common for full-service projects, typically £1,800-2,500 per square meter. This structure provides cost certainty and ensures comprehensive service delivery.

Fixed Price Arrangements: Suitable for well-defined projects with clear scope. Fixed prices provide cost certainty but require detailed project definition to avoid scope creep and additional charges.

Hourly Rates: Appropriate for consultation work, feasibility studies, or projects with uncertain scope. Rates typically range from £75-150 per hour depending on specialist experience and location.

Factors Affecting House Extension Costs

Project Complexity: Complex designs, challenging sites, or unusual requirements increase design time and costs. Heritage projects, listed buildings, or projects requiring specialist expertise command premium rates.

Location and Planning Constraints: Projects in conservation areas, green belt locations, or areas with restrictive planning policies require additional design work and planning expertise, increasing costs.

Scope of Services: Full-service house extension packages including project management, contractor selection, and construction supervision cost more than design-only services but often provide better value overall.

Breaking Down House Extension Service Costs

Initial Consultation and Feasibility: Typically £500-2,000, including site visit, initial assessment, and preliminary design concepts. This investment helps determine project viability and provides realistic cost estimates.

Planning Application Services: Usually £2,000-8,000 depending on complexity, including design development, application preparation, and planning officer negotiations. Complex applications or those requiring specialist reports cost more.

Building Regulations Drawings: Detailed technical drawings typically cost £3,000-10,000, including structural details, specifications, and compliance documentation.

Construction Supervision: Ongoing site visits and project management typically cost 2-4% of construction value, ensuring quality control and compliance throughout construction.

Budgeting Strategies for House Extensions

Start with Feasibility Studies: Invest in professional feasibility assessment before committing to full design services. This upfront investment prevents costly mistakes and ensures realistic project expectations.

Phase Your Investment: Many specialists offer phased services, allowing you to proceed step-by-step and reassess at each stage. This approach provides flexibility and cost control throughout the design process.

Consider Value Engineering: Work with your specialist to identify cost-effective design solutions that maintain quality while reducing construction costs. This collaborative approach often achieves significant savings.

Hidden Costs to Consider

Planning Application Fees: Local authority fees for planning applications range from £206 for householder applications to several thousand pounds for major developments.

Building Regulations Fees: Building regulations approval typically costs £200-1,000 depending on project size and complexity.

Specialist Reports: Projects may require structural surveys, ecological assessments, or heritage reports, typically costing £500-3,000 each.

Getting Quotes and Comparing Services

When requesting house extension quotes, ensure you're comparing like-for-like services. Request detailed breakdowns of included services, timelines, and any additional costs. Consider not just price but also specialist experience, local knowledge, and track record with similar projects.
